Index of /ttepla.com/upload/iblock/086/57ggqs4p0z7m44jbs5l3x0ukq2fskpic
Name
Last modified
Size
Description
Parent Directory
-
IMG_20231002_153448.jpg
2024-08-05 19:43
310K